BST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2018 in Review

52 of the 4,488 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in BlackRock Science and Technology Trust (BST) for Q4 2018, worth a combined $116M — down 26% from $158M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 10 funds closed out of BST and 7 opened new positions — a net loss of 3 holders — while 20 trimmed existing stakes and 14 added.

The largest buyer was Weiss Asset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$1.18M. The largest seller was Bank of America, cutting an estimated $4.41M.
